Изучение программного обеспечения, необходимого для организации оперативного управления предприятия

Характеристика структуры локальной вычислительной сети планового отдела. Обоснование выбора среды разработки Windows-приложения. Анализ создания шаблона модели базы данных. Требования к центральному процессору и оперативному запоминающему устройству.

Рубрика Программирование, компьютеры и кибернетика
Вид дипломная работа
Язык русский
Дата добавления 10.02.2018
Размер файла 1,9 M

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же

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.

для непрерывного контроля помещения и зоны хранения носителей информации установлена система обнаружения пожаров. Для этого использованы комбинированные извещатели типа КИ-1. Эта система сконструирована так, что обеспечивает отключение систем питания и кондиционирования воздуха. В сочетании с системой обнаружения используется система звуковой сигнализации. [30]

Меры пожарной безопасности, определенные в ГОСТ 12.1.004-85

выполняются.

Оператор информационной подсистемы допускается к выполнению работ только после прохождения инструктажа по безопасности труда и пожарной безопасности.

В данном разделе описаны и проанализированы опасные и вредные факторы, а также меры их профилактики на рабочем месте пользователя ПК. Рассмотрены требования по безопасности работы с компьютером.

Общая освещенность рабочего кабинета в течение рабочего дня в среднем составляет 452 лк, на уровне 0,8 м от пола, что соответствует СанПиН 2.2.2.542-96. Сочетание естественного и искусственного освещения обеспечивает оптимальную освещенность.

В результате анализа условий труда пользователя ПК было определено, что все правила электробезопасности и меры по пожарной безопасности соблюдены.

Заключение

Воздействие роста объема информации и сокращение времени ее обработки не совсем однозначно. Ясно, что улучшение качества информации, имеющейся в момент принятия решения, позволяет руководству принять обоснованное, своевременное решение. Немедленная передача подробной информации способствует координации деятельности физически разобщенных подразделений. Однако огромный объем циркулирующей в настоящее время информации все больше затрудняет нахождение и выделение нужных и относящихся к делу сведений. Информация является одним из основных ресурсов роста производительности. Более эффективное использование информации приобретает все более важное значение для обеспечения производительности всей организации.

Основным результатом дипломного проектирования является разработка, на основе использования современных CASE- технологий, информационной подсистемы, автоматизирующей ведение баз данных планового отдела СПК колхоз «Гигант».

В результате дипломного проектирования было показано, что:

- полные затраты на создание программного продукта- 41280,25 руб.;

годовой эффект от внедрения программного продукта составляет 39895,00 руб.;

чистый дисконтированный доход за 4 года использования программного продукта равен 39895,00 руб.;

срок окупаемости проекта 1,03 года;

после внедрения программного продукта ежемесячные затраты времени специалиста планового отдела СПК колхоз «Гигант» на ведение базы данных сократились примерно в 7 раз.

В целом предлагаемые мероприятия по совершенствованию ведения базы данных специалиста планово-экономического отдела позволяют значительно повысить эффективность деятельности данного предприятия.

Таким образом, приходим к заключительному выводу о том, что разработка информационной подсистемы является экономически обоснованной и эффективной.

К перспективным направлениям развития темы выпускной квалификационной работы можно отнести расширение функциональных возможностей разработанной информационной подсистемы.

Список использованных источников

1. Устав СПК колхоз «Гигант», Сотниковское, 2006. - 135 с.

2. Петров В.Н. Информационные системы =СПб.: Питер, 2012 г. - 688с.:ил.

3. Оливер В.Г. IP-сети: Стратегическое планирование корпоративной ИВС - М.: Питер, 2011.

4. Хомоненко А.Д. Базы данных. =СПб.: «КОРОНА принт», 2010 г.

5. Бережная Е.В, Бережной В.И. Математические методы моделирования экономических систем: Уч. пособие. -М.: Финансы. и статистика, 2011.-368 с.

6. Острековский В.А. Информатика: Учебник для вузов.- М.: Высшая школа, 2011. - 511с.;

7. Советов Б.Я. Информационная технология: Учеб. для вузов по спец. «Автоматизир. системы обработки информ. и упр.». - М.: Высшая школа, 2012.

8. Хомоненко А.Д., Цыганков В.М., Мальцев М.Г. Базы данных: Учебник для высших учебных заведений. - СПб.: КОРОНА принт, 2009.

9. Глушаков С.В., Ломотько Д.В. Базы данных: Учебный курс. - Харьков: Фолио; М.: ООО "Издательство АСТ", 2008.

10. Косарев В.П. Компьютерные системы и сети.М.: Финансы и статистика, 2010

11. Дейт, К., Дж. Введение в системы баз данных, 7-е издание: Пер. с англ. - М.: Издательский дом "Вильямс", 2009.

12. Дунаев С. Доступ к базам данных и техника работы в сети. =М.: Диалог -=МИФИ, 2008 г.

13. Автоматизированные информационные технологии в экономике: Учебник/ Под ред. проф. Г.А. Титоренко - М.: ЮНИТИ, 2011 г. - 399с.

14. Голицына О.Л., и др. Базы данных: Учебное пособие. - М.: ИНФ А-М, 2011. - 352 с.

15. Р. Стивинс. Программирование баз данных. Пер.с англ. -М.: ООО «Бином - Пресс», 2009.-384 с.

16. Автоматизированные информационные технологии в экономике [Текст]: Учебник/Под ред. проф. Г.А. Титоренко. ? М.: Компьютер, ЮНИ- ТИ, 2008.

17. Маклаков, С.В. BPwin и ERwin. CASE-средства разработки информационных систем [Текст]/ С.В. Маклаков. ? М.: ДИАЛОГ-МИФИ, 2010.

18. Чекалов, А. Базы данных: от проектирования до разработки приложений [Текст]/ А. Чекалов. - СПб.: БХВ. ? Петербург, 2009. - 340 с.

19. Архангельский, А. Я. Программирование в Delphi [Текст] / А. Я. Архангельский. - М.: ООО «Бином-Пресс», 2007. - 1152 с.

20. Тейксера, Стив, Пачеко, Ксавье. Borland Delphi 6 [Текст] / Стив Тейксера, Ксавье Пачеко. Руководство разработчика. : Пер. с англ. - М.: Издательский дом «Вильямс», 2010. - 1120 с..

21. Баженова, И. Ю. Delphi 7 Самоучитель программиста [Текст] / И. Ю. Баженова. - М.: Кудиц-Образ, 2011. - 436 с.

22. Культин, Н. Б. Основы программирования в Delphi 7 [Текст] / Н. Б. Культин. - СПб.: БХВ-Петербург, 2012. ? 608 с.

23. Гофман, В.Э, Хомоненко, А. Д. Delphi 5 [Текст] / В.Э. Гофман, А. Д. Хомоненко. - СПб.: БХВ, 2008. ? 800 с.: ил.

24. Тейксера Стив, Пачеко Ксавье. Borland Delphi 5. Руководство разработчика. : Пер. с англ. - М.: Издательский дом «Вильямс», 2009. - 817 с..

25. Кандзюба, С. П., Громов, В. Н. Delphi 6. Базы данных и приложения. Лекции и упражнения [Текст] / С. П. Кандзюба, В. Н. Громов. - К.:Издательство «ДиаСофт», 2007. - 576 с.

26. Епанешников, А. М., Епанешников, В. А. DELPHI. Программирование СУБД [Текст] / А. М. Епанешников, В. А. Епанешников. - М.: ДИАЛОГ-МИФИ, 2011 - 528 с.

27. Коробкин, В.И., Передельский Л.В. Экология [Текст]/ В.И. Коробкин. - Ростов-на-Дону, «Феникс», 2010 - 576 с.

28. Федеральный закон «Об охране окружающей среды» Вып. 5[Текст]/ - М.: Инфра-Н, 2012, - 51 с.

29. Гарин, В.М. и др. Экология для технических вузов [Текст]/ В.М. Гарин. ? Ростов н/Д: «Феникс», 2007. - 384 с.

30. Инженерная экология: Учебник [Текст] / Под ред. В. Т. Медведева. ? М.: Гардарики, 2012. - 687 с.

31. Розанов, С.И. Общая экология: Учебник [Текст]/ С.И. Розанов. ? СПб., «Лань». - 2012. - 288 с.

Приложение

Рисунок 1 - Организационная структура Общества

Листинг- Основные компоненты, с которыми нам предстоит работать при создании приложения

procedure Topen.BitBtn1Click(Sender: TObject); begin

ADOQuery1.Active:=true; ADOQuery2.Active:=true;

ADOQuery3.Active:=true; ADOQuery4.Active:=true;

ADOQuery5.Active:=true; ADOQuery6.Active:=true;

ADOQuery7.Active:=true; ADOQuery8.Active:=true;

ADOQuery9.Active:=true; ADOQuery10.Active:=true; ADOQuery11.Active:=true; ADOQuery12.Active:=true; ADOQuery13.Active:=true; open.Close;

ShowMessage('Соединение успешно установлено'); end;

procedure Topen.BitBtn2Click(Sender: TObject);

begin open.Close; end;

procedure Topen.Button1Click(Sender: TObject); begin

adoconnection1.Connected:=false; ADOQuery1.Active:=false;

DOQuery2.Active:=false; ADOQuery3.Active:=false;

DOQuery4.Active:=false; ADOQuery5.Active:=false;

DOQuery6.Active:=false; ADOQuery7.Active:=false;

DOQuery8.Active:=false; ADOQuery9.Active:=false;

DOQuery10.Active:=false; ADOQuery11.Active:=false;

DOQuery12.Active:=false; ADOQuery13.Active:=false;

If OpenDialog1.Execute then begin FilePath:=Opendialog1.FileName; Edit1.Text:=Opendialog1.FileName;

end;

adoconnection1.ConnectionString:='Provider=Microsoft.Jet.OLEDB.4.0;Dat a Source=' +FilePath+';Persist Security Info=False';

ADOConnection1.LoginPrompt := False;

ADOConnection1.Connected:=true;

ADOQuery1.Connection:=adoconnection1; ADOQuery2.Connection:=adoconnection1;

ADOQuery3.Connection:=adoconnection1;

ADOQuery4.Connection:=adoconnection1;

ADOQuery5.Connection:=adoconnection1;

ADOQuery6.Connection:=adoconnection1;

ADOQuery7.Connection:=adoconnection1;

ADOQuery8.Connection:=adoconnection1;

ADOQuery9.Connection:=adoconnection1;

ADOQuery10.Connection:=adoconnection1;

ADOQuery11.Connection:=adoconnection1;

ADOQuery12.Connection:=adoconnection1;

ADOQuery13.Connection:=adoconnection1; end;

end.

Листинг- Пример для месяца январь

procedure Tanaliz.Button1Click(Sender: TObject); //январь begin

DBGrid1.DataSource:=open.DataSource1; bool1:=true;

bool2:=false; bool3:=false; bool4:=false; bool5:=false; bool6:=false;

ool7:=false; bool8:=false; bool9:=false; bool10:=false; bool11:=false;

ool12:=false; end;

и далее if bool1 then begin

(например, функция удаления) open.ADOQuery1.Delete;

end; end.

Листинг- Кнопка экспорт в Exсel procedure Tanaliz.Button15Click(Sender: TObject); begin

ExcelApp := CreateOleObject('Excel.Application'); ExcelApp.Visible := true; ExcelApp.WorkBooks.Add(-4167);

ExcelApp.WorkBooks[1].WorkSheets[1].name := 'analiz_raboti';

heet:=ExcelApp.WorkBooks[1].WorkSheets['analiz_raboti']; index:=1;

DBGrid1.DataSource.DataSet.First;

for i:=1 to DBGrid1.DataSource.DataSet.RecordCount do begin

for j:=1 to DBGrid1.FieldCount do sheet.cells[index,j]:=DBGrid1.fields[j-1].asstring; inc(index);

DBGrid1.DataSource.DataSet.Next; end;

end.

Листинг- экспорт значений компонента «dbgrid» в Excel таблицу

procedure Tanaliz.Button15Click(Sender: TObject); begin

ExcelApp := CreateOleObject('Excel.Application'); ExcelApp.Visible := true; ExcelApp.WorkBooks.Add(-4167);

ExcelApp.WorkBooks[1].WorkSheets[1].name := 'analiz_raboti'; sheet:=ExcelApp.WorkBooks[1].WorkSheets['analiz_raboti']; index:=1;

DBGrid1.DataSource.DataSet.First;

for i:=1 to DBGrid1.DataSource.DataSet.RecordCount do begin

for j:=1 to DBGrid1.FieldCount do sheet.cells[index,j]:=DBGrid1.fields[j-1].asstring; inc(index);

DBGrid1.DataSource.DataSet.Next; end;

end.

Размещено на Allbest.ru


Подобные документы

Работы в архивах красиво оформлены согласно требованиям ВУЗов и содержат рисунки, диаграммы, формулы и т.д.
PPT, PPTX и PDF-файлы представлены только в архивах.
Рекомендуем скачать работу.